Did Thomas Cole paint the Oxbow outdoors?
Thomas Cole painted The Oxbow outdoors we know this to be true because he places himself with an easel in the foreground of the work. … Cole was the first great landscape painter in . . .

Who often created equestrian statues of their emperors?
The Romans
The Romans often created statues of their emperors showcasing them as equestrians. They were used to mark celebrations like victories.

The painter and draftsman Hubert Robert who spent eleven years in Rome (1754-65) studying at the French Academy is known for his picturesque capriccios – views of the city combining real and imaginary ancient monuments. This capriccio features the famous ancient bronze equestrian statue of Marcus Aurelius.
